Series  01

De Terra

A series inspired by geological phenomena — the composition and structure offered by the natural and biological processes of our planet. A dynamic cycle visualised through abstract and geometric forms, where a vast chromatic range of shapes and textures intertwine, immersing the viewer entirely in the work.

About

Plastic
artist

I am a plastic artist who creates abstract paintings. My visual proposal presents reflections on the environments, both the natural and the urban — an artistic search that aims to interpret a vast world that surrounds man. An aesthetic atmosphere where the pictorial dimension embraces the spectator and allows them to enjoy an experience of forms intertwined among colours and lines.

I normally use very large formats as this allows me to give dimension to the sensations I want to generate: stroked colour jungles and faintly revealed structures. Nature, as well as the city, are represented on large canvas to suggest the idea of vastness, enormity and power — in order to lose oneself within the poetic horizons of the image.

It is more a poetic than a direct work, more metaphoric than illustrative; it is mostly the inexorable feeling that the world, in one way or another, is hard to discern and grasp in its vastness.

Series  02

Urban
Landscape

Cities are organic components where human life is circumscribed — the city grows, mutates, rearranges and reconfigures itself constantly. Texture and colour are the elements that form the basis of this series, representing through wounds, cavities and textures the symptomatic displays of the urban spectrum.
